Is there are a good front end tool for Nagios that can 
A) have profiles that we can apply to multiple hosts
B) ideally stores in MySQL db (well, this is not really a requirement, 
as apparently there are perl modules that can potentially load a mysql 
db).

Please don't recommend Fruity/GroundWork, as apparently it pukes on 
2500+ monitors, or a certain number of hosts (at least GroundWork did 
for us in version 4.51, which is why we plan to ditch it)
